What they do

A Director of Urban / Transportation Planning directs and oversees planning and develops projects that maintain or improve the quality of life in a city or region. Addresses specific transportation, economic development, housing and environmental issues. Directs planning to address aesthetic and technical concerns, community goals and the future impact of development.

Job Description

Our Deloitte Strategy & Transactions team helps guide clients through their most critical moments and transformational initiatives. From strategy to execution, this team delivers integrated, end-to-end support and advisory services covering valuation modeling, cost optimization, restructuring, government operations modernization, business design and transformation, infrastructure and real estate, mergers and acquisitions (M&A), and sustainability. Work alongside clients every step of the way, helping them navigate new challenges, avoid financial pitfalls, and provide practical solutions at every stage of their journey-before, during, and after any major transformational projects or transactions. Work you'll do Help clients in the higher education sector (primarily universities and public university systems) understand how to assess, prioritize, and plan to implement strategies and tactics in an increasingly complex and challenged operating environment. The role combines rigorous research skills, strong quantitative analysis, clear business case development and professional writing, effective management of diverse sets of stakeholders, and a sharp point of view on how organizations work - applied to a moment when the structure of work, the shape of the workforce, and the operating models of the entire sector are being rewritten. Successful candidates bring intellectual curiosity, structured thinking, strong communication skills, and the ability to translate analysis on fast-moving competitive environments and technology trends into recommendations on which their clients can act. They are experienced in their careers and demonstrate the judgement, communication skills, and business awareness needed to support high-profile strategy engagements. As a Manager, Strategy, Growth, and Transformation on the Strategy, Growth, and Transformation team, you will be responsible for...
  • Leading workstreams across strategy, growth, operating model, and transformation engagements from problem definition through implementation planning
  • Managing day-to-day engagement activities, project plans, risks, deliverables, and stakeholder communications across cross-functional teams
  • Facilitating workshops and meetings with client stakeholders to align on priorities, decisions, and next steps
